The ingredients needed to make Gastric Bypass Chili:
  1. Get 1/2-1 tablespoon oil
  2. Get 16 oz. ground turkey or chicken, skin removed
  3. Make ready 1 envelope chili seasoning, low salt
  4. Make ready 1 teaspoon Mrs. Dash Seasoning or 1/2 teaspoon Adobe seasoning
  5. Prepare to taste creole seasoning -
  6. Make ready 1 clove garlic,smashed and minced
  7. Make ready 1/4-1/2 cup bread crumbs
  8. Take 1/4-1/2 cup water
  9. Get to crockpot
  10. Make ready 2 packets truvia, for reducing acidity
  11. Prepare 2 cans - 15 ounces each - black beans - drained and rinsed well
  12. Prepare 2 cans - 15 ounces each - pinto bean - drained and rinsed well
  13. Prepare 2 cans - 28 ounces each chunky tomatoes
  14. Prepare 1 can tomato paste
  15. Get 1/2 cup water
Steps to make Gastric Bypass Chili:
  1. In dutch oven or 12-inch pan, heat oil over medium heat until rippling. Add ground meat and cook til it begins to brown
  2. Add seasonings and water. Continue to brown while breaking up meat to small pieces. Add in bread crumbs.
  3. To crockpot, add ingredients listed in to crockpot. after meat is cooked, transfer to crockpot and put on low heat for 8-18 hours. Or high for 2-4 hours
  4. If you're not using a crockpot, simmer in large pot for 20-60 minutes on low with cover, stirring every 10 minutes.
